Understanding Cosentyx: A Biologic Medication

Cosentyx, also known as secukinumab, is a monoclonal antibody that targets interleukin-17A (IL-17A), a protein involved in the inflammatory process. By blocking IL-17A, Cosentyx reduces inflammation and slows down disease progression in patients with autoimmune diseases.

Benefits of Cosentyx in Psoriatic Arthritis

Psoriatic arthritis (PsA) is a chronic condition characterized by joint pain, stiffness, and swelling, often accompanied by skin psoriasis. Cosentyx has been shown to be effective in reducing symptoms of PsA, including joint pain and swelling, and improving physical function and quality of life.

Benefits of Cosentyx in Ankylosing Spondylitis

Ankylosing spondylitis (AS) is a type of arthritis that primarily affects the spine, leading to chronic pain, stiffness, and limited mobility. Cosentyx has been shown to be effective in reducing symptoms of AS, including pain and stiffness, and improving spinal mobility and quality of life.

Benefits of Cosentyx in Plaque Psoriasis

Plaque psoriasis is a chronic skin condition characterized by red, scaly patches on the skin. Cosentyx has been shown to be effective in reducing symptoms of plaque psoriasis, including the size and severity of skin lesions, and improving quality of life.

Variability in Cosentyx Benefits

While Cosentyx has shown remarkable efficacy in improving symptoms and quality of life for many patients, its benefits can vary depending on the patient's condition, disease severity, and individual response to the medication. For example:

* Disease severity: Patients with more severe disease may require higher doses of Cosentyx or longer treatment durations to achieve optimal benefits.
* Patient response: Some patients may respond better to Cosentyx than others, depending on their individual genetic and environmental factors.
* Comorbidities: Patients with comorbidities, such as diabetes or cardiovascular disease, may experience different benefits from Cosentyx compared to patients without comorbidities.
